🌾 Gluten-free / celiac travel
Gluten-free in 10 European cities.
Celiac disease requires zero cross-contamination — not just “gluten-friendly” menus. We flag venues with dedicated GF kitchens, separate fryers, and celiac-association certification. When a city doesn’t have them, we say so.
Each city guide below lists specific venues — not vague “Gluten-free-friendly” hand-waving — cross-referenced with OpenStreetMap tags and, where it exists, local certification. We name the neighbourhoods where options cluster, flag the cities where choices are genuinely thin, and link every guide back to that city's full trip planner so you can build gluten-free eating into a real itinerary rather than treating it as an afterthought.
